What is Low Keng Huat (Singapore) Asset Turnover?

Low Keng Huat (Singapore) SGX:F1E 53 Asset Turnover is 0.04 as of Jul. 2025. GuruFocus rates SGX:F1E with a GF Score™ of 53/100 and a GF Value™ of S$0.38. The stock has 10 warning signs investors should review.

Asset Turnover measures how quickly a company turns over its asset through sales. It is calculated as Revenue divided by Total Assets. Low Keng Huat (Singapore)'s Revenue for the six months ended in Jul. 2025 was S$38.7 Mil. Low Keng Huat (Singapore)'s Total Assets for the quarter that ended in Jul. 2025 was S$1,019.2 Mil. Therefore, Low Keng Huat (Singapore)'s Asset Turnover for the quarter that ended in Jul. 2025 was 0.04.

Asset Turnover is linked to ROE % through Du Pont Formula. Low Keng Huat (Singapore)'s annualized ROE % for the quarter that ended in Jul. 2025 was -3.44%. It is also linked to ROA % through Du Pont Formula. Low Keng Huat (Singapore)'s annualized ROA % for the quarter that ended in Jul. 2025 was -1.99%.

Be Aware

In the article Joining The Dark Side: Pirates, Spies and Short Sellers, James Montier reported that In their US sample covering the period 1968-2003, Cooper et al find that firms with low asset growth outperformed firms with high asset growth by an astounding 20% p.a. equally weighted. Even when controlling for market, size and style, low asset growth firms outperformed high asset growth firms by 13% p.a. Therefore a company with fast asset growth may underperform.

Therefore, it is a good sign if a company's Asset Turnover is consistent or even increases. If a company's asset grows faster than sales, its Asset Turnover will decline, which can be a warning sign.

Low Keng Huat (Singapore) Asset Turnover Calculation

Asset Turnover measures how quickly a company turns over its asset through sales.

Low Keng Huat (Singapore)'s Asset Turnover for the fiscal year that ended in Jan. 2025 is calculated as

Asset Turnover
=Revenue/Average Total Assets
=Revenue (A: Jan. 2025 )/( (Total Assets (A: Jan. 2024 )+Total Assets (A: Jan. 2025 ))/ count )
=482.705/( (1215.993+1091.028)/ 2 )
=482.705/1153.5105
=0.42

Low Keng Huat (Singapore)'s Asset Turnover for the quarter that ended in Jul. 2025 is calculated as

Asset Turnover
=Revenue/Average Total Assets
=Revenue (Q: Jul. 2025 )/( (Total Assets (Q: Jan. 2025 )+Total Assets (Q: Jul. 2025 ))/ count )
=38.738/( (1091.028+947.462)/ 2 )
=38.738/1019.245
=0.04

Low Keng Huat (Singapore) Business Description

Address 80 Marine Parade Road, No. 18-05/09 Parkway Parade, Singapore, SGP, 449269
Low Keng Huat (Singapore) Ltd is a Singapore-based builder engaged in the business segments which include Property Development, Hotels, and Investments. The Property Development segment is engaged in the development of properties, the Hotel segment is engaged in owning and operating hotels and restaurants, and the Investments segment is engaged in investment in properties and shares in quoted and unquoted equities. Geographically, the group has a business presence in Singapore, Australia, and Malaysia, of which key revenue is generated from Singapore.
